In order to regain security after experiencing a cyber attack, several measures need to be taken, including:
1. Containment: Immediately isolate the affected systems to prevent the spread of the attack and limit further damage.
2. Assessment: Conduct a thorough investigation to determine the extent of the breach and identify the vulnerabilities that were exploited.
3. Remediation: Address the vulnerabilities that were exploited during the attack and apply patches or updates to secure the systems.
4. Communication: Keep all stakeholders informed about the situation, including employees, customers, and any relevant authorities.
5. Enhanced Security Measures: Implement stronger security protocols, such as multi-factor authentication, encryption, and regular security audits.
6. Employee Training: Provide cybersecurity awareness training to employees to prevent future incidents.
7. Backup and Recovery: Ensure that regular backups are in place and that a robust data recovery plan is established to restore systems in the event of an attack.
8. Monitoring: Implement continuous monitoring systems to detect and respond to any suspicious activities in real-time.
9. Incident Response Plan: Develop and regularly test an incident response plan to ensure a swift and effective response to future cyber attacks.
10. Engage with a Cybersecurity Professional: Consider seeking assistance from cybersecurity experts to assess your systems, recommend improvements, and enhance overall security posture.
These measures can help organizations recover from a cyber attack and strengthen their defenses against future threats.
